    Portfolio Overview: Procedural 3D Animation & Growth Systems

    Below is a collection of my recent 3D animation work, primarily created in Houdini with some pieces in Cinema 4D. My core focus is fully procedural, growth-based systems built in Houdini. I’ve developed a suite of art-directable tools that can evolve in multiple ways and styles, adapting seamlessly to any form or geometry. This approach enables rapid iteration and creative freedom—once I refine a setup, it can be reused and customized for countless new applications with minimal effort. Each project showcases a fully procedural approach.

    Cell-to-Brain Growth

    A single cell divides and evolves into a full brain using three growth systems:

    • Vellum: Soft, tissue-like dynamics
    • Particles: Granular detail and control
    • VDB Advection: Smooth, fluid expansion

    All are designed to be repurposed for any shape or application.

    Infrared Sauna Animations

    • Layered Pyro & Growth: Art-directed flames, smoke, and text reveals through multiple solvers.
    • Vein Growth & UV-Video Textures: A surface-based vein solver supporting UVs and video assets.
    • Smoke & Particle Triggers: A modified growth solver that activates particle streams and smoke.

    AVL (Audio, Video, Lighting) Logo Transformation

    • A procedural sequence transitions through AV elements before forming the logo—demonstrating multi-stage, Houdini-driven animations.

    Health Brand Particles (Cinema 4D)

    • A dynamic particle setup for a health-focused brand. While this leverages C4D, most of my pipeline revolves around Houdini’s advanced simulations.

    Can Animations & FLIP Fluid Systems

    • Three can animations rely heavily on Houdini’s complex FLIP fluid simulations, where particle speed dictates foam and bubble generation. One includes my growth solver integrated with layered noise, showcasing how a single tool can yield varied results.

    Power Washing Reel: C4D + Houdini

    • A combined approach—Cinema 4D handles core shapes, while Houdini adds procedural growth effects for an energetic, flowing visual.

    Web Company Cogwheel Rig

    • A concluding sequence featuring a cogwheel rig and a flexible arm on the logo—carefully rigged to prevent distortion and maintain smooth mechanical motion.

    Procedural & Reusable

    • All of these growth solvers, fluid setups, and pyro systems reside in my personal Houdini library. Once developed, they can be plugged into new projects and retuned on the fly—making it possible to explore vastly different aesthetics without rebuilding from scratch. This procedural backbone ensures efficiency, consistency, and limitless creative potential across a wide variety of animations.
